As part of an entrepreneurial team in this rapidly growing business, you will play a key role in understanding the needs of our customers and helping shape the future of HPC.
As the Senior Manager in High Performance Computing (HPC), you will be responsible for driving the strategy, growth, and customer success for the HPC business in North America. You will lead a team of HPC specialist sales and customer engineers to develop and grow long-term HPC partnerships, accelerate adoption, and expand GCP's (Google Cloud Platform) leadership position. You will collaborate across sales, product, engineering, and finance and operate at the C-level internally and externally.

The US base salary range for this full-time position is $186,000-$261,000 + bonus + equity + benefits. Our salary ranges are determined by role, level, and location. Within the range, individual pay is determined by work location and additional factors, including job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training. Your recruiter can share more about the specific salary range for your preferred location during the hiring process. Please note that the compensation details listed in US role postings reflect the base salary only, and do not include bonus, equity, or benefits.
